#f95463 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f95463 is composed of 97.6% red, 32.9% green and 38.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 66.3% magenta, 60.2% yellow and 2.4% black. It has a hue angle of 354.5 degrees, a saturation of 93.2% and a lightness of 65.3%. #f95463 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a8c6 with #f30000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6666.

#f95463 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f95463 has RGB values of R:249, G:84, B:99 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.66, Y:0.6,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 16340067.
